电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

台达plc编程详细指令

2023-11-21 00:34分类:PLC编程入门 阅读:

 

本文主要介绍了台达PLC编程详细指令。从多个方面对台达PLC编程进行了详细阐述,包括数据处理指令、逻辑控制指令、通信指令、定时器和计数器指令、运算指令等。通过对这些指令的详细介绍,可以更好地了解和掌握台达PLC编程。

数据处理指令

数据处理指令是台达PLC编程中常用的一类指令,用于对数据进行处理和操作。其中,包括数据传送指令、数据比较指令、数据转换指令等。数据传送指令用于将数据从一个寄存器传送到另一个寄存器;数据比较指令用于比较两个数据的大小或相等关系;数据转换指令用于将数据转换为不同的数据格式。

例如,MOV指令用于将一个寄存器中的数据传送到另一个寄存器中。CMP指令用于比较两个数据的大小。CONV指令用于将一个数据转换为另一种数据格式,如将十进制数转换为二进制数。

通过数据处理指令,可以对数据进行灵活的处理和操作,实现不同的功能和逻辑。

逻辑控制指令

逻辑控制指令是台达PLC编程中用于实现逻辑控制的指令。其中,包括逻辑运算指令、位操作指令、跳转指令等。逻辑运算指令用于进行逻辑运算,如与、或、非等运算;位操作指令用于对位进行操作,如置位、清零等;跳转指令用于根据条件进行跳转。

例如,AND指令用于进行与运算,OR指令用于进行或运算,NOT指令用于进行非运算。SET指令用于将某一位置位,RST指令用于将某一位清零。JMP指令用于根据条件进行跳转。

通过逻辑控制指令,可以实现复杂的逻辑控制和判断,提高程序的灵活性和可扩展性。

通信指令

通信指令是台达PLC编程中用于实现与外部设备通信的指令。其中,包括数据传输指令、通信控制指令、网络通信指令等。数据传输指令用于将数据从PLC传输到外部设备或从外部设备传输到PLC;通信控制指令用于控制通信的启动和停止;网络通信指令用于实现PLC之间的通信。

例如,MOV指令用于将数据从PLC传输到外部设备或从外部设备传输到PLC。START指令用于启动通信,STOP指令用于停止通信。NET指令用于实现PLC之间的通信。

通过通信指令,可以实现PLC与外部设备之间的数据交换和通信,提高系统的整体效率和性能。

定时器和计数器指令

定时器和计数器指令是台达PLC编程中用于实现定时和计数功能的指令。定时器指令用于实现定时功能,计数器指令用于实现计数功能。其中,包括定时器启动指令、定时器停止指令、计数器启动指令、计数器停止指令等。

例如,TON指令用于启动定时器,TOF指令用于停止定时器。CTU指令用于启动计数器,CTD指令用于停止计数器。

通过定时器和计数器指令,可以实现对时间和次数的精确控制,满足不同应用场景的需求。

运算指令

运算指令是台达PLC编程中用于实现数学运算的指令。其中,包括加法指令、减法指令、乘法指令、除法指令等。运算指令可以对数据进行基本的数学运算,如加法、减法、乘法、除法等。

例如,ADD指令用于实现加法运算,SUB指令用于实现减法运算,MUL指令用于实现乘法运算,DIV指令用于实现除法运算。

通过运算指令,可以对数据进行复杂的数学运算,实现更加精确和灵活的控制。

台达PLC编程详细指令包括数据处理指令、逻辑控制指令、通信指令、定时器和计数器指令、运算指令等。通过对这些指令的详细介绍,可以更好地了解和掌握台达PLC编程,实现各种复杂的控制和运算。

台达PLC编程详细指令包括数据处理指令、逻辑控制指令、通信指令、定时器和计数器指令、运算指令等。这些指令可以实现对数据的处理和操作、逻辑控制、通信、定时和计数、数学运算等功能。通过对这些指令的灵活应用,可以实现各种复杂的控制和运算,提高系统的性能和效率。

上一篇:台达plc编程语言有哪些类型

下一篇:台达plc编程详解

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部